I was there in September, and I asked a CM in tomorrowland. He said Push comes out on the hours, starting at 10. Dont know if that's always true or only for when I was there. We saw him 2 times using this knowledge, he was by the bridge to tomorrowland one time, and in front of StarTraders the other time.

In MK it is Push the trash can
In AK it is Wes Palm the palm tree at the park entrance and
Pipa the recycle bin at Conservation Station

I think I read that Wes Palm no longer comes out.
 
We found the times listed on the Steve Soares site reliable for PUSH sightings when we were there in September of this year. PUSH was close to the Buzz Lightyear Spin ride, beside the Lunching Pad. My DS loves seeing PUSH.

He was in the same spot in 2009 and we also found Steve Soares' times reliable then.
